Understanding the Product Category and Technical Specifications
When sourcing an interactive touch screen magazine rack, buyers must first distinguish between the core mechanical structure and the integrated digital interface. The provided market data indicates that the underlying physical units are primarily categorized as display stands, racks, or commercial furniture designed for indoor display places. These units are constructed using robust materials, with observed specifications listing Metal, Steel, Aluminum, Stainless Steel, and combinations of Wood and Metal. The structural integrity is critical, as these racks often support the weight of heavy tablets or touch monitors alongside the physical magazines they hold.
The manufacturing process for these units involves precise fabrication techniques such as bending, laser cutting, welding, and powder coating. These processes ensure that the metal frames can withstand frequent interaction and the physical handling of media. The surface treatment is consistently noted as powder coating, which provides a durable finish available in standard colors like Red and Black, or customized options to match corporate branding. The physical dimensions are highly flexible, with size specifications listed as "as Required" or "Custom Made," allowing for tailored solutions that fit specific retail or lobby environments.
A key technical observation is the structural configuration. The racks are often designed with a "Without Door" attribute, ensuring unobstructed access to the media. The units are typically in an "Unfolded" state for operation but feature "Disassembly" capabilities for efficient shipping and storage. Height adjustability is a common feature, allowing the touch screen interface to be positioned at ergonomic levels for different user demographics. The tolerance for manufacturing precision is observed in the range of +/- 0.05mm to +/- 0.1mm, indicating a high standard of fit and finish for the metal components. The rotary mechanism is generally fixed, providing stability for the interactive display, though the specific model "Slender (SY)" suggests a variety of form factors are available in the market.

Cost Drivers and Pricing Dynamics
The pricing structure for interactive touch screen magazine racks is influenced by a complex interplay of material costs, customization levels, and order volume. The observed market price range spans from 4.98 USD to 224.92 USD. This significant variance is not indicative of a single product type but rather reflects the difference between basic structural racks and fully integrated units with high-end interactive screens. The lower end of the range likely corresponds to the metal frame or the rack component alone, while the upper end includes the cost of the touch screen technology, internal mounting hardware, and advanced finishing.
Material selection is a primary cost driver. Units constructed from Stainless Steel or Aluminum generally command higher prices than those made from standard Steel or Wood+Metal composites. The choice of surface treatment also impacts cost; while powder coating is standard, specialized finishes or custom color matching (Red, Black, or custom) may incur additional charges. Furthermore, the "Custom Made" nature of many units means that tooling and design fees can be amortized over the order quantity, making unit costs highly sensitive to the Minimum Order Quantity (MOQ).
The MOQ range observed in the market is 1 to 500 units. This flexibility allows small businesses to test the market with a single unit, while larger enterprises can leverage economies of scale. The data explicitly notes that products are "Cheaper for Large Quantity," suggesting a tiered pricing model where the unit cost decreases as the order volume increases. Buyers should also consider the "Remark" regarding large quantities, which implies that negotiation leverage increases significantly with volume. Additionally, the production time of 4-8 weeks or 7-25 days depending on quantity indicates that rush orders may carry a premium, affecting the total landed cost. Payment terms, typically T/T, should be factored into the financial planning, as they influence cash flow and potential discounts for early payment.
Typical Applications and Operational Use Cases
The primary application for these units is within the commercial furniture sector, specifically designed for indoor display places. The "Specific Use" is identified as a Magazine Rack, but the integration of an interactive touch screen expands their utility far beyond traditional media storage. These units are ideal for retail environments, corporate lobbies, hotels, and exhibition centers where digital engagement is required alongside physical media. The "General Use" classification as Commercial Furniture confirms their suitability for high-traffic public areas.
The design features align closely with specific operational needs. The "Without Door" attribute ensures that users can easily access both the physical magazines and the touch screen interface without obstruction. The "Height Adjustable" feature is crucial for accessibility, allowing the interactive screen to be positioned for users of varying heights or for wheelchair accessibility in public spaces. The "Fixed" rotary mechanism provides a stable base, preventing the unit from tipping when a user interacts with the screen or removes heavy magazines.
In terms of logistics and deployment, the "Disassembly" and "Folded: Unfolded" attributes are significant. These racks are designed to be shipped in a knock-down or flat-pack format to minimize shipping volume and cost. The "Carton with Knock Down Loading" and "Board Packing in Carton" methods facilitate efficient transport. Once on-site, the units are assembled and unfolded for use. This modularity is particularly beneficial for events or temporary installations where the racks may need to be relocated or stored. The "Indoor" display place specification means these units are not intended for outdoor exposure, protecting the sensitive electronic components from weather damage.
